# Learn From the Best

Analyze any codebase's patterns and apply the best ones to your project.

## Process

### Phase 1: Analyze Source

Ask for the source project directory (must be cloned locally):
- "Which repo do you want to learn from? Provide the local path."

```bash
node ${CLAUDE_PLUGIN_ROOT}/tools/pattern-analyzer.mjs <source-directory> --compare=<your-project-directory>
```

Parse the JSON output.

### Phase 2: Pattern Report

Present the source project's patterns:

**Project Structure:**
- How they organize code (feature-based, layer-based, hybrid)
- Naming conventions
- Key directories

**Testing Strategy:**
- Framework and location
- Test-to-source ratio
- Integration vs unit separation

**Code Quality:**
- Average file length
- Export patterns
- Linting and formatting setup

**TypeScript Practices:**
- Strict mode usage
- Type vs interface preference
- `any` count

**Error Handling:**
- Custom error classes
- Middleware patterns
- Global handlers

**CI/CD:**
- Pipeline setup
- Automated steps

### Phase 3: Comparison

Show side-by-side comparison between the source project and yours:

For each area, show:
- What they do vs what you do
- Whether the difference matters
- Specific recommendation

### Phase 4: Adoption Plan

Create a prioritized adoption plan:

**Priority 1 (High Impact, Low Effort):**
- Enable TypeScript strict mode
- Add linting/formatting config
- Adopt naming conventions

**Priority 2 (High Impact, Medium Effort):**
- Add test framework and initial tests
- Create custom error classes
- Add CI pipeline

**Priority 3 (Medium Impact, Higher Effort):**
- Restructure project directories
- Add integration tests
- Improve documentation

### Phase 5: Apply Patterns

For each pattern the user wants to adopt, implement it:

1. **TypeScript strict mode** — update tsconfig.json, fix resulting errors
2. **Test framework** — install vitest/jest, create first test, add test script
3. **Error handling** — create base error class, add error middleware
4. **CI pipeline** — create .github/workflows/ci.yml with lint, test, build
5. **Linting** — add eslint config matching source project's style

Only apply patterns the user explicitly approves.
